yes they did brett. thru to 75 the 808 was the same body as the rx3, just fitted with a 4 banger. in 76 changes were made to the looks that made it very different to the rx3. front nose was made less pointy and it went from 4 to 2 headlights. they got different taillights too. mine being the last yr using the rx3 body, the swap was a breeze. drill out spot welds and remove the 4 cyl engine mounts. the rotary engine mount cross member uses the swaybar mounting point to the frame. swap out the single coil mount for the dual one and wire in the 2nd coil. the dash already had the rx3 gauges with tac w/ over rev buzzer. it was a fun ride while it lasted.
